Units explained
MeV/c2
MeV/c^2 expresses mass through mass-energy equivalence, E = mc^2; 1 MeV/c^2 is about 1.783E-30 kg.
Derived from Einstein's mass-energy relation, convenient for particle masses.
Particle physics, where masses are stated in MeV/c^2 or GeV/c^2.
Came into use with relativistic particle physics in the 20th century.
Deuteron Mass
The deuteron mass is about 3.344E-27 kg.
The mass of the deuteron, the nucleus of deuterium (one proton and one neutron).
Nuclear physics and fusion-energy research.
Established with the discovery of deuterium by Harold Urey in 1931.
MeV/c2 to Deuteron Mass conversion formula
Note: this conversion uses a generally accepted modern value. Historical and regional definitions of this unit varied across times and places.
The relationship between mev/c2 and deuteron mass:
To convert mev/c2 to deuteron mass, multiply the value in mev/c2 by 0.0005331587. To reverse, multiply deuteron mass by 1875.6141938568.
